Hi folks, as MD I can confirm that the IPSC Nationals will be held - August 13-18 2018 at the Selkirk Game & Fish Association ranges in East Selkirk MB. The range is about 45 minutes North of Winnipeg.

We are working on a lot of details, but you can bookmark the match website and watch for updates: http://nationals.ipscmanitoba.com/
RSS: http://nationals.ipscmanitoba.com/feed/

Hope to see you in 2018!

p.s. Manitoba Provincials tentative dates are Aug 4 & 5, pending range bookings.

Pleased to let you know that the match schedule has been decided:

Registration & pre-match – Monday August 13
Main match – August 14-17
Banquet & shoot off/rain day – August 18th

I'm also very happy to say that Wolverine Supplies will be our match sponsor!
XMetal Targets has signed on as a Gold sponsor. We are looking for more sponsors, interested parties should contact nationals@ipscmanitoba.com

The four day schedule fits with our goals of hosting as many competitors as possible while maintaining match quality. The current plan is to have competitors shoot two half days and work one full day.
